GAINESVILLE, GA. — In order to meet rising demand for premium, functional and human-grade pet nutrition, pet treat manufacturer Big Creek Foods and European pet nutrition company Scholtus Special Products B.V. have teamed up to expand their production of air-dried and semi-moist pet treat and food products. By combining their respective capabilities in science-driven nutrition, premium sourcing and scalable production, Big Creek Foods and Scholtus will offer pet brands an “unprecedented opportunity” to bring the next generation of functional pet nutrition products to the market. 

Founded in 2014, Big Creek Foods aims to redefine pet treat manufacturing in the United States, focusing on premium, US-made jerky treats. During the past two years, the company has expanded its operations with a new, state-of-the-art facility in Gainesville that specializes in air-dried treats, whole-muscle jerky, as well as semi-moist and functional pet nutrition products. 

Established in 1981 in the Netherlands, Scholtus has served as a pioneer in the European pet nutrition market, specifically focusing on scientifically formulated, high-quality pet snacks for cats and dogs. The company’s portfolio includes training treats, dental chews, soft chews, sticks and pet supplements formulated with functional ingredients and developed in collaboration with veterinary specialists, and more. Scholtus operates facilities in Renswoude, Helmond and Gouda, Netherlands, and has a contract partner in China. The company uses four production processes, including dehydration, cold extrusion, extrusion and hot extrusion, to create its products.

In 2023, Scholtus acquired Big Creek Foods, providing Big Creek Foods with global reach, new manufacturing capabilities, and enhancing its custom solutions for private-label pet brands. According to the companies, they offer the widest range of premium pet treats currently available on the market. 

Through their partnership, the companies’ enhanced capabilities include:

  • Formed jerky, whole-muscle jerky, jerky bites, semi-moist treats and sticks, training treats, functional treats and soft chew supplements for cats and dogs at Big Creek Foods’ Gainesville facility. 
  • Twists, sticks, dual extruded treats, cheese puffs/pops, hot dogs, supplements, dental sticks, cat pillows, cat treats and grain-free snacks for cats and dogs at Scholtus’s operations in the Netherlands. 
  • Formed jerky, whole-muscle jerky, wrapped meat treats, jerky bites, raw hide chews, no-hide chews, pressed bones and knotted bones for cats and dogs through a partnership with contract partners in China.

With an expanded global footprint, the companies’ customers now have access to premium manufacturing in both continents, reducing transportation costs for East Coast and European distribution, according to Scholtus and Big Creek Foods.

In addition to continuing to enhance their production capabilities, Scholtus and Big Creeks Foods are dedicated to setting a standard for product quality and food safety, aspects that are imperative as pet food recalls rise and consumers become more interested in ingredient transparency.  According to the companies, their facilities meet the strictest global standards and tout state-of-the-art safety protocols.
